Safari忽略z-index值

时间:2014-11-21 22:28:59

标签: jquery css safari z-index

早上好,

我在使用我正在处理的网站时遇到了问题。 我有一个滑块用于我的照片和下拉菜单。 它可以在其他所有浏览器上正常工作,但在Safari中,我的滑块位于下拉菜单的顶部。

在Safari(Mac版)中,

enter image description here

在其他浏览器中,

enter image description here

我已将z-index添加到我的菜单CSS中,如下所示(然后它开始在其他浏览器上工作)

#cssmenu {
  font-family: Montserrat, sans-serif;
  background: #333333;
  /*Always on top of everything*/
  z-index: 999;
}

2 个答案:

答案 0 :(得分:0)

完成一个完整的浏览器缓存后,这个CSS似乎已经有效了

#cssmenu {
    font-family: Montserrat, sans-serif;
    background: #333333;
    z-index: 999;
    position: relative;
}

答案 1 :(得分:0)

我有类似的问题,虽然在元素上设置z-index(在我的情况下是缩略图)除了Safari之外的所有工作,我还必须在包含div上设置z-index,现在也适用于safari。